Show Notes

This week I got to catch up with the very formidable and very personable - Suz Steele. Suz has been the running Adode ANZ for the past 3 years and says that she has hit her sweet spot at Adobe! They  are true innovators, like being a 40 year old startup and Suz absolutely loves her job!

We talk about Digital transformation and how this has been affected by COVID. Suz believes that Digital has progressed ten years in the past 6 months. Have a listen to how Suz and the team at Adobe didn't just replicate their previous office days and meetings at Adobe but rather they reset, reviewed and adapted how they meet and when to get the greatest impact. Plus we also discussed Suz's amazing career and what has been the biggest help to Suz in her career. 

We also talked about how Adobe supports women and diversity - you are going to be really impressed! Adobe have reached pay parity globally which is incredible plus we are also going to talk about 'Opportunity parity'.
